Output 0c8fd5eb1434986e151daed9433c23f5d1d187172bf0cb21a80283e9985a40f9:3

value
346368
script pubkey
OP_0 OP_PUSHBYTES_20 43cd999ef0e776deb9ddc355afe4ba17d515af2e
address
bc1qg0xen8hsuamdawwacd26le96zl23ttewpyuuks
transaction
0c8fd5eb1434986e151daed9433c23f5d1d187172bf0cb21a80283e9985a40f9
spent
true